3D Printing in Dental Surgery



To boost the area of oral surgery, you can check out the subtopic of 3D printing in oral surgery. This innovative modern technology has the prospective to change the method dental specialists run and treat people. Below are four crucial methods which 3D printing is forming the area:

- ** Custom-made Surgical Guides **: 3D printing enables the production of very precise and patient-specific surgical overviews, boosting the precision and performance of procedures.

- ** Implant Prosthetics **: With 3D printing, oral surgeons can develop customized implant prosthetics that perfectly fit an individual's unique composition, resulting in far better results and person satisfaction.

- ** Bone Grafting **: 3D printing allows dentla dental manufacturing of patient-specific bone grafts, lowering the requirement for conventional grafting methods and improving healing and recovery time.

- ** Education and Training **: 3D printing can be utilized to develop realistic surgical designs for instructional purposes, permitting oral cosmetic surgeons to practice complicated treatments prior to executing them on patients.

With its potential to enhance accuracy, personalization, and training, 3D printing is an interesting development in the field of oral surgery.

Minimally Invasive Strategies



To additionally advance the area of dental surgery, embrace the possibility of minimally invasive techniques that can significantly benefit both surgeons and clients alike.

By making use of innovative imaging innovation, such as cone light beam computed tomography (CBCT), surgeons can accurately intend and carry out surgical treatments with very little invasiveness.

Furthermore, the use of lasers in dental surgery enables specific tissue cutting and coagulation, causing decreased bleeding and lowered healing time.

With minimally intrusive methods, people can experience faster recovery, minimized scarring, and enhanced results, making it an essential element of the future of oral surgery.
